20140207623 | PRICE DIFFERENTIATION BY MARKET FOR IN-APP SOFTWARE PURCHASES - Different prices may be charged for an In-App Purchase (IAP) for a same item based on a market associated with the user. For example, a user in one market may be charged a different price for an item than what is charged for the item to a user in a different market. A different product identifier is associated with the item for each of the different markets for the item. The item is submitted to the application store as different items that have the different product identifiers for each of the different markets. When an IAP request for an item is received from a user, a market that is associated with the user is determined based on a location associated with the user. After determining the market for the user, the product identifier that identifies the product is used to obtain the item from the application store. | 2014-07-24 |

20140207647 | Total Fair Value Swap - A synthetic instrument known as a “Total Fair Value Swap” is disclosed. According to one embodiment, the Total Fair Value Swap may comprise an agreement between two counterparties, a “Fixed Rate Payer” and a “Floating Rate Payer”. According to the agreement, the Fixed Rate Payer makes a stream of payments to the Floating Rate Payer based on a fixed rate, and the Floating Rate Payer makes a second stream of payments to the Fixed Rate Payer based on a floating rate, wherein a first portion of the floating rate is based on a reference interest rate, and wherein a second portion of the floating rate is based on a credit spread associated with the Floating Rate Payer. The reference interest rate may be, for example, London Inter-Bank Offer Rate (LIBOR), prime interest rate, the US dollar swap rate, the U.S. Treasury Bond rate or any other widely traded interest rate that is reset periodically. The credit spread may be observed from the Credit Default Swap (CDS) market. | 2014-07-24 |
20140207648 | LEVERAGED INSTRUMENT COMPUTER-IMPLEMENTED TRADE MANAGEMENT SYSTEM TO PROVIDE LONG-TERM EXPECTED RETURNS FOR DAILY REBALANCE INSTRUMENTS, SUCH AS ETFS OR FUNDS - A computer-implemented system enables performance of leveraged instruments, such as leveraged ETFs, to track their design parameters for longer durations than currently possible. The computer-implemented method issues sells and buys of the leveraged instrument on a daily basis to return the instrument back to an expected value, and to credit or debit cash on a daily basis, such that a combination of the instrument position and the cash position taken together provides an actual return close to the theoretical stated return. This strategy involves bringing the leveraged holding back to an equal value of the unleveraged ETF at the time the leveraged ETF is rebalanced—generally at the close of trading on any given day. This technique allows investors to hold the leverage only through the day, and realize the losses and gains of the leverage that day, and resets the position for trading for the following market day. | 2014-07-24 |
